Operations Executive
Operations Executives Formulate Operational Strategies And Objectives To Ensure The Organization Meets Its Goals And Operates Successfully. They Support Other Top Executives, The Organization'S Board Of Directors.
Responsibilities
- Oversee And Direct Financial Budgets, Personnel And Operations.
- Ensure Operations Function To Promote Growth And Meet Financial Objectives.
- Short And Long-Term Planning And Assessing Of The Budget To Ensure Annual Profit Goals Are Met.
- Develop And Manage Systems And Resources Within The Company That Help The Business Achieve Its Stated Goals.
- Responsible For Creating Policies And Procedures That Help The Company Function Optimally
- Influential Role In Hiring And Personnel Management
- Maintaining Proper Staffing Levels And Ensuring That Positions Are Filled With Qualified Personnel;
- Providing Training Opportunities For Human Resources Staff.
- Responsible For Overseeing Operations More Broadly
- Assessments Of Various Teams And Departments.
- Hold Meetings, Commission Reports, And Often Even Make Trips To Observe Different Parts Of The Business As They Work.
- Make Valuable Suggestions For New Ways Forward, And Is An Important Part Of Corporate Planning.
- Project Administration And Collecting Outcomes For Project Evaluation, Data Analysis And Reports
